    [Shaman] See anywhere!

    Alright, I'm not sure if this is working as intended.. From my knowledge, Far See is supposed to be LOS from your character. BUT, it's LoS from the current Far see. So, if you cast it on a building, you can recast from the PoV of that Farsee, and it goes on and on. If this is working as intended I'll delete the post or something.
